What is the difference between a crescent and a croissant?

Crescent Rolls Vs Croissants The two are very similar, but croissants have more of a puff pastry dough making them extra flaky. Crescent rolls have more of a homemade roll texture.

Is it safe to eat Pillsbury crescent rolls raw?

Don’t taste or eat raw (unbaked) dough or batter. Don’t let children handle or play with raw dough, including play clay and dough for crafts. Uncooked flour and raw eggs can contain germs that can make you sick if you taste raw dough.

Do you dip croissant in coffee?

The only other thing you need with your croissant is a large cup of coffee in which to quickly dunk it. Where extra butter adds a new layer of luxurious creaminess, coffee offers an earthy, complimentary bitter contrast while intensifying the sweetness of the croissant. It gives the croissant a new, deeper resonance.
